Abstract:
A wireless cellular base station includes M antennas and one or more processing devices. For each antenna, the antenna transmits a calibration pilot symbol over the air and the other M−1 antennas receive the calibration pilot symbol over the air. The processing devices select one of the M antennas as a reference antenna and for each antenna of the M antennas, the processing devices calculate channel reciprocity calibration coefficients of the antenna with respect to the reference antenna based on the received calibration pilot symbols.
